数据库中function是什么函数

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,function是一种用于处理和操作数据的函数。它可以接受一个或多个参数,并返回一个值或执行一个操作。数据库中的函数可以用于各种目的,包括数据转换、数据验证、聚合计算等。

    以下是数据库中常见的几种函数:

    1. 聚合函数:聚合函数用于对一组数据进行计算并返回单个结果。常见的聚合函数包括SUM(求和)、AVG(求平均值)、COUNT(计数)、MAX(最大值)和MIN(最小值)等。这些函数可以用于统计数据、生成报表等。

    2. 字符串函数:字符串函数用于处理和操作文本字符串。例如,LEN函数可以用于计算字符串的长度,CONCAT函数可以用于将多个字符串连接起来,SUBSTRING函数可以用于提取字符串的子串等。

    3. 数学函数:数学函数用于执行数学运算。例如,ABS函数可以用于取绝对值,ROUND函数可以用于四舍五入,SQRT函数可以用于计算平方根等。

    4. 日期和时间函数:日期和时间函数用于处理和操作日期和时间数据。例如,DATE函数可以用于提取日期部分,TIME函数可以用于提取时间部分,DATEDIFF函数可以用于计算日期之间的差距等。

    5. 条件函数:条件函数用于根据条件来执行不同的操作。例如,IF函数可以根据指定的条件返回不同的值,CASE函数可以根据多个条件执行不同的操作等。

    这些函数可以在SQL语句中使用,以实现对数据库中的数据进行处理和操作。它们提供了一种方便和灵活的方式来处理数据,使得数据库的查询和分析更加高效和准确。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,function(函数)是一种用于执行特定任务或返回特定结果的可重用代码块。它可以接受输入参数,并根据这些参数执行一系列操作,最后返回一个结果。

    数据库中的函数通常分为两种类型:系统函数和用户定义函数。

    1. 系统函数:系统函数是数据库管理系统(DBMS)提供的内置函数,用于执行各种常见的操作。它们可以用于处理数据、执行数学运算、字符串操作、日期和时间处理、类型转换等。例如,常见的系统函数包括SUM(求和)、AVG(平均值)、COUNT(计数)、MAX(最大值)、MIN(最小值)等。

    2. 用户定义函数:用户定义函数是由用户自定义的函数,用于满足特定的业务需求。用户可以根据自己的需求定义函数,并在需要的地方调用它们。用户定义函数可以接受参数并返回结果,可以执行复杂的逻辑和计算。用户定义函数可以是标量函数、表值函数或多值表值函数。标量函数返回单个值,表值函数返回结果集,多值表值函数返回表。

    函数在数据库中具有以下优点:

    • 重用性:函数可以在多个地方调用,避免了重复编写相同代码的问题。
    • 可维护性:如果函数需要更改,只需要修改函数定义,而不需要修改调用函数的地方。
    • 封装性:函数可以将一系列操作封装在一个函数中,使代码更加简洁和可读性。
    • 提高性能:函数可以在数据库层面执行,避免了频繁的数据传输和处理。

    总而言之,函数是数据库中的一种可重用代码块,用于执行特定任务或返回特定结果。它可以是系统函数或用户定义函数,用于处理数据、执行计算、字符串操作、日期和时间处理等。函数的使用可以提高代码的可维护性、重用性和性能。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,function(函数)是一种用于执行特定任务或计算特定值的可重复使用的代码块。数据库中的函数可以用于执行各种操作,例如数据处理、数据转换、数据验证等。

    数据库中的函数可以分为以下几类:

    1. 系统函数:这些函数是数据库管理系统提供的内置函数,用于执行常见的操作。例如,日期和时间函数、字符串函数、数学函数等。系统函数通常具有固定的语法和返回值。

    2. 用户定义函数(UDF):这些函数是由用户自定义的函数,用于执行特定的业务逻辑。用户可以根据自己的需求编写自定义函数,并将其保存在数据库中以供重复使用。UDF可以是标量函数(返回单个值)、表值函数(返回表)或多语句表值函数(返回多个表)。

    3. 存储过程:存储过程是一组预编译的SQL语句,可以接收输入参数并返回输出参数。存储过程可以执行复杂的业务逻辑,可以包含条件判断、循环和异常处理等。存储过程通常用于执行一系列相关的数据库操作,并可以通过调用来执行。

    4. 触发器:触发器是与数据库表相关联的特殊类型的函数。当指定的事件(例如插入、更新或删除)发生时,触发器会自动执行。触发器可以用于实现数据完整性、数据校验、日志记录等功能。

    使用数据库函数可以提高数据库的灵活性和可重用性,可以减少代码的重复编写。使用函数还可以将复杂的业务逻辑封装起来,使数据库操作更加简洁和高效。在编写和使用数据库函数时,需要注意函数的输入参数和返回值,以及函数的执行效率和性能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部